Xicor Announces a New Family of INTEGRATED System Management ICs

--Targeted at mixed signal applications in many embedded processor systems


MILPITAS, California – July 23, 2001 – Xicor, Inc. (Nasdaq/NMS: XICO) today announced the availability of the first System Management ICs to integrate Xicor Digitally Controlled Potentiometers (XDCPs). The X40231, X40233, X40235, X40237 and X40239 INTEGRATED System Management ICs include Power-on-reset, Triple Voltage Monitors, 2 kbit EEPROM integrated with one or two XDCPs in a 16-pin package.

Integrating XDCPs with a CPU supervisor function adds new capabilities for embedded system designers without adding additional components. XDCPs can be used for applications such as:
  • Optimizing throughput for DDR SDRAM, RAMBUS, GTL BUS or other SSTL
    (Series Stub Terminated Logic) Interfaces by adjusting VTT, Vref and VDDQ
  • Varactor/PIN Diode Control for RF Systems in Industrial PDAs
  • LCD control – adjusting contrast, purity or backlight, in portable products such as
    POS Terminals and LCD TV/Displays
  • Computerized Instrumentation – XDCPs used to measure/adjust sensors in Portable
    Test Equipment and Medical Instrumentation
  • Power Supply Margining in Telecom Systems
The INTEGRATION of the X4023x Family enables system designers to add more functionality in less space. A discrete IC implementation of the main blocks of the X40239 would require two potentiometers, a CPU Reset/triple voltage monitor and 2k EEPROM would take 32-36 pins and 1 sq inch. The X4023x is only 16 pins and takes .16 sq inches – the discrete solution is 600% bigger! Triple Voltage Monitors enhance reliable power-on, fault detection and recovery. Most processors or embedded processor ASICs have both an I/O voltage and a Core voltage. These processors may be in an undefined state when the supplies are not within the manufacturer-specified tolerance causing erroneous operation. Voltage Monitors are used to hold the processor in RESET when these faults occur. Most embedded systems also need memory to store a serial number, manufacturer data, configuration data and customer parameters.
